Abstract for Post: Haematological Impact of Telfairia occidentalis and Talinum triangulare Leaf Extracts in Albino Rats

The effects of aqueous leaves extracts of Telfeiria occidentalis and Talinum triangulare on haematological parameters in albino rats were studied using Auto Haematology Analyzer by Mindray BC 2800. Twenty (20) albino rats were randomly distributed into four (4) groups of five (5) rats each. Group 1 served as control and received only standard feed and water, group 2 received 250 mg/Kg of aqueous leaf extract of T. Occidentalis, group 3 received 250 mg/Kg of T. triangulare and group 4 received 250 mg/Kg mixture of T. occidentalis and T. triangulare of 1:1 weight by weight for 21 days. Administration of the extracts were done orally. At the end of the treatment period, haematological parameters such as white blood cell count, red blood cell count, platelet count, haematocrit, haemoglobin concentration, mean corpuscle volume, mean corpuscle haemoglobin and mean corpuscle haemoglobin concentration were determined. The results showed no significant change (p>0.05) in all haematological parameters except white blood cell count (p<0.05) in group 2, 3 and 4 as compared to the control group. In conclusion, the results of the study shows that, the leaf extract of T. Occidentalis and T. Triangulare administered through the period of this study has positive effect only on the white blood cell count, there was no increase on the other Haematological parameters (RBC, PCV, Hb Conc. and platelet) in the treated rats when compared with the control group (p>0.05).
